Ticket: Catalog cache invalidation broken since Monday. Root cause: the credential used by Shelfwright's invalidation worker to call the internal Purgebus service expired; no alert fired because expiry monitoring only covers user tokens, not service keys. Impact: stale product pricing served up to 4 hours. Fix: issued replacement credential with 60-day lifetime and added it to the rotation tracker. Requesting security review sign-off before deploy. New key for review below.

app token of yajeg-kawef = kto11_7En3XSX8xQw

**Runbook: ScaleSpoon recipe calculator misbehaving.** If users report scaled ingredient amounts coming back as zero, it's usually the fraction-parsing service choking on mixed numbers like "1 1/2 cups." First, bounce the parser pod — nine times out of ten that clears it. If not, check whether the Dellhaven unit-conversion table got a bad deploy; roll it back and rerun the smoke suite. Don't touch the cache layer, it self-heals. The smoke suite prints its run token right under this section.

pipeline stamp: htk31_f769b577b3028a4e9958e5bb8d1259a

Loading Dock — Delivery Hours. The dock at Calder Point accepts deliveries Monday to Friday, 07:30–15:00. Couriers must sign the dock ledger and remain beside their vehicle. Pallets left after 15:00 go to the overflow cage. Facilities staff opening the dock shutter outside these hours should use the override pad with this code.

staff pass of kawep-hahap = bdg-IEUUF-6

- [ ] Before the ceremony starts, confirm the Quillbore queue-depth autoscaler is frozen — we don't want worker pods churning while plugin authors verify their hooks. Flip the `scaler.hold` flag in the Tandry console and leave it until step 9. The ceremony coordinator will need the recovery passphrase below.

recovery phrase for fajep-yaweg: gilath-sorox-wenius-rusdor-keliel-zorius